Cornell-Dubilier DME Series
Cornell Dubilier DME series radial-leaded, mini-dipped capacitors. The DME series is a compact package that delivers the same performance of other capacitors physically bigger. The DME series offers improvements in film technology that permits the use of thinner dielectric. The DME series self-heals shorts caused by overvoltage transients.
